## Divestiture of the Coastal Logistics Unit — Managers Only

The board is asked to note progress on the proposed sale of Harrowvane Group's coastal logistics unit to Tellisbrook Holdings. Due diligence concluded in March; valuation remains within the range approved at the February session. Staff transfers in the Port Amery depot are being negotiated under the retention framework drafted by Marit Oulson. Completion is targeted for the end of Q3. The strategic rationale is summarised in the note below.

board note of kageg-bahof: The renewal with Holwynax Holdings closes at $2 million a year, 5 percent below the last contract. Project Ulaath slips by two quarters because of the supplier delay.

## Deploying the Gatewick Proctor Queue

Deploys are pretty painless: push to main, wait for the pipeline, then watch the queue drain dashboard for five minutes. If candidates pile up mid-exam, roll back first and ask questions later — the queue replays safely. Everything the workers care about lives in one config block, shown here for reference.

settings of bafof-yagef:
JOROX_PIN=8740
JOROX_TENANT=pelox
JOROX_METRICS_HOST=metrics.jorox.qorvelworks.internal
JOROX_SEAL=seal_c78f63c1
JOROX_STANDBY_TEAM=norax

TURN-208: Gatevale turnstile counters at the Merrow Field pilot double-count when a rotation reverses mid-cycle. Attendance totals drift roughly 2% high per event. The debounce window fix is implemented, reviewed by Ilsa, and soak-tested across two simulated match days without drift. Ready for your cut; the candidate build is identified below.

trace token, tagag-tafog: htk6_5ed18c